The Product Snapshot

We're not reviewing a piece of hardware or software, but a meticulously designed service product: a premium, private, appointment-only fitness studio experience. Founded in Melaka, KIN has built a cult following with its flagship offering, 'The Vault,' and is now exporting this model to Thailand.

  • 📦 Product: The Vault (Private Fitness Studio Experience)
  • 🏷️ Category: Premium Fitness & Wellness Services
  • 💸 Price Range: Premium Tier (Estimated MYR 300-500+ per session, based on package)
  • 🎯 Target Audience: High-net-worth individuals, time-poor executives, entrepreneurs, and anyone seeking privacy, customization, and zero intimidation in their fitness journey.

The Deep Dive: Features & Experience

Upon entering a Vault location, the first thing users will notice is the stark contrast to a commercial gym. There are no crowds, no waiting for equipment, and no performance anxiety. The experience is built on three pillars: Absolute Privacy (you book the entire studio), Hyper-Personalization (every session is tailored by a dedicated elite trainer), and Convenience as a Luxury (flexible scheduling, all amenities provided).

For the business executive, this means turning what is typically a crowded, time-consuming chore into an efficient, results-focused appointment. The 'anti-gym' ethos solves key pain points: wasted time, lack of personalized attention, and the discomfort of public workouts. The USPs are clear: it's not about access to more machines, but access to undivided expertise, guaranteed privacy, and time efficiency. The model competes less with other gyms and more with high-end personal concierge services.

Under The Hood: Specs & Performance

  • Session Model: 100% Private, 50-75 minute one-on-one or duo sessions.
  • Trainer Ratio: 1:1 or 1:2 (Client:Trainer), ensuring maximum focus.
  • Facility Footprint Compact, high-spec studio containing all essential strength, conditioning, and recovery equipment for a comprehensive workout.
  • Tech Integration: Seamless app-based booking, progress tracking, and bespoke program design accessible to client and trainer.
  • Yield Metric: High client retention and satisfaction rates (implied by 4-year growth and international expansion).
